Tying On Success: Mastering Fly Fishing Techniques for Beginners
Embarking on a journey into the captivating world of fly fishing can feel challenging at first. Mastering the art of casting and picking the right flies requires patience and practice, but the rewards are immeasurable. This article will provide you with some fundamental techniques to help you launch your fly fishing adventure on the right foot.
- Understanding your tools is paramount. Get acquainted with your rod, reel, line weight, and different types of flies to ensure a harmonious match.
- Practice your casting style in an open space. Start with short, controlled casts and gradually increase the distance as you build confidence.
- Presenting your fly naturally is key to enticing a strike. Practice different presentation techniques to imitate the movement of insects.
Remember, fly fishing is a skill that takes time and dedication to master. Don't be dejected by early setbacks. Embrace the learning process, experiment with different approaches, and most importantly, enjoy the serenity and beauty of being on the water.
